Transaction 14b7966957e4fc9cf3aa241d021d03fd3f020a4927da436218d153012c704f54

110 Input
2 Outputs
  • 14b7966957e4fc9cf3aa241d021d03fd3f020a4927da436218d153012c704f54:0
  • value  896848
    address  1Egd6pcjQ6G6VcGyLk8F4N6LKT3PwLohL4
  • 14b7966957e4fc9cf3aa241d021d03fd3f020a4927da436218d153012c704f54:1
  • value  3160817487
    address  322jbUQKvzJKw34yVVNrmgZJ9ueq17tGRb